we want to deploy a CAS 5.1 server with the Maven Overlay method under Cent 
OS7, Java 1.8.0 and Tomcat 8.0.
Currently I am trying to set up authentication against LDAP.

The configuration I am using is fairly simple:
cas.authn.ldap[0].type=AUTHENTICATED
cas.authn.ldap[0].useSsl=false
cas.authn.ldap[0].ldapUrl=ldap://...:3890
cas.authn.ldap[0].bindDn=cn=manager,dc=example,dc=org
cas.authn.ldap[0].bindCredential=secret
cas.authn.ldap[0].baseDn=dc=example,dc=org
cas.authn.ldap[0].userFilter=uid={user}
cas.authn.ldap[0].subtreeSearch=true


During start up of Tomcat the CAS server initializes a connection pool. 
In the log there are three consecutive 

beginning pool initialization...
...
execute request=[org.ldaptive.BindRequest@261320823...
execute response=[org.ldaptive.Response@753570317...
[request and response happens 2 more times here]
added available connection: org.ldaptive.pool.AbstractConnectionPool

So in total there are 9 BindRequests+Responses during initialization. When 
looking at the LDAP server's logs I can also verify 9 BIND requests. So 
everything works as expected.

 When looking at the LDAP server's logs I also do not see anything. It's 
like the request never leaves the server that is running CAS.

Now the funny thing is: when I restart the LDAP server now and try to login 
again it does work! Another bind occurs, since the connection is no longer 
available and I get a response to the SearchRequest. Obviously the LDAP 
server log does also reflect this and shows the search operation:

execute request=[org.ldaptive.SearchRequest@128569139
Operation exception encountered, reopening connection
...
execute request=[org.ldaptive.BindRequest@1701619972
execute response=[org.ldaptive.Response@844611484
execute 
response=[org.ldaptive.Response@430713277::result=[org.ldaptive.SearchResult
Authentication succeeded for dn: uid=t.benutzer,ou=people,dc=example,dc=org

I pretty much tried every timeout setting that is documented 
in 
https://apereo.github.io/cas/5.1.x/installation/Configuration-Properties.html 
and also played around with the Passivator settings.
When I set up an validator the same thing happens: there is no Response to 
the SearchRequests and in fact the LDAP server is never receiving any 
requests.
